Model for Minimizing the Volume of Two-Bearing Shafts
Russian Engineering Research Pub Date : 2020-09-01 , DOI: 10.3103/s1068798x20080031
B. M. Abdeev , G. A. Gur’yanov , E. A. Klimenko

Abstract

A universal approach is proposed for optimizing the geometric parameters of two-bearing stepped shafts, so as to minimize the volume of a shaft consisting of three steps, with two adapters. The solution is appropriate for three design variants. A computational algorithm based on the model is derived for the optimization process. A numerical example is presented.
